Output 8b89854c7e8c9a5a84139250311c2d4e66112913ea543a2d9b5dbf78951b3ae7:6

value
2491909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c7379d6c307c6da04b8f77fd66fb035cda68c0 OP_EQUAL
address
32VRywCcBRxC2pBGSiPfG3x2JYpYSXMPac
transaction
8b89854c7e8c9a5a84139250311c2d4e66112913ea543a2d9b5dbf78951b3ae7
spent
true